Output 66628132badfc164568534887885ec4227f59f59fcdfd567078758a3356ca2ca:1

value
1091573
script pubkey
OP_0 OP_PUSHBYTES_20 c0c8a159121388fb7fb78706763f90013b7300cb
address
bc1qcry2zkgjzwy0klahsur8v0usqyahxqxtv03cc3
transaction
66628132badfc164568534887885ec4227f59f59fcdfd567078758a3356ca2ca
spent
true